Ideal Students
A bachelor's degree in engineering is required for admission into the Semiconductor Safety certificate program. Texas A&M University computes GPR (Grade Point Ratio) on a four-point scale for each applicant. Generally, a minimum of 3.0 is required to be considered for admission.

Curriculum
To qualify for this certificate, you must complete 12 semester credit hours (SCH) of required and elective coursework. You must complete two required foundation courses (6 credits) and two elective courses (6 credits).
Required Courses (6 credits):
- CHEN 675 - Microelectronics Process Engineering
- CHEN 649 - Nanomaterials for Energy Conversion (OR) SENG 689 - Vapor Phase Techniques for Semiconductor Manufacturing
Electives (6 credits):
Select two of the following:
- SENG/CHEN 655 - Process Safety Engineering
- SENG 689 - Material Safety in Semiconductor Manufacturing
- SENG 689 - Process Safety in Semiconductor Manufacturing
